Re: Maple Offroad Sliders
Beers wouldn’t have helped me, quite the opposite lol. Did mine myself as well. Used the front end loader on my tractor to get them 95% there and was able to just used my knees while laying underneath to position them the rest of the way. Have had them on for two months and no noises at all.

Re: Rear reverse light pods
Rigid sells a wiring kit just for this. Has a 3 position switch. Off, on, and auto which makes them work when put in reverse.
